Building permits are essential authorized paperwork required before commencing any construction or renovation project. Understanding building permits is essential for homeowners, contractors, and real estate developers alike.
The function of building permits is to guarantee that all construction complies with native codes and rules. These codes are designed to protect public health, safety, and welfare. Without proper permits, tasks could face authorized challenges, financial losses, or even be pressured to halt construction.
Obtaining a building permit sometimes entails a quantity of steps. First, applicants must submit detailed plans and specifications of the meant work. This documentation is reviewed by the native building division to determine if the project meets zoning laws and building codes.
Once plans are accredited, a permit is issued allowing the project to proceed legally. However, there could additionally be circumstances attached to the permit. Compliance with these situations is significant, as failing to adhere to them may end up in fines or the revocation of the permit.

Building permits are not uniform and can differ considerably by location. Each municipality has specific building codes that replicate its distinctive environmental and architectural needs. Homeowners must familiarize themselves with local requirements to avoid unnecessary issues.
The forms of construction that typically require permits embrace new builds, major renovations, and alterations that affect structural aspects. Even minor initiatives, similar to putting in fences or sheds, would possibly need permits depending on native regulations.

Moreover, the permitting course of can take various amounts of time. Factors such as the project's complexity and local paperwork can have an effect on approval times. A easy remodeling job might receive swift approval, while bigger constructions could require extra extensive evaluation and consideration.
Other issues contain the necessity for inspections during totally different phases of construction. Inspections ensure that the work performed is according to the permitted plans and meets safety standards. These inspections could be necessary and assist catch potential issues earlier than they turn out to be serious problems.
Building permits are sometimes associated with costs, together with the permit fee. These fees can differ broadly depending on the scope of the project and native laws. Budgeting for these bills is essential to keep away from unexpected financial strain throughout construction.
For householders and contractors, understanding the implications of not acquiring necessary permits is crucial. If a project is constructed without a permit, it may not solely end in fines but can also lead to difficulties when promoting the property sooner or later. Prospective patrons usually require verification of permits for any vital work carried out on the home.

Historical buildings often face stricter regulations relating to renovations or enhancements. Navigating the building permit process may be daunting, however various assets can be found to assist householders and contractors. Local building departments usually present guidelines and may supply recommendation on tips on how to proceed with applications. Additionally, many municipalities now supply on-line portals for submitting applications and tracking the status of permits.
In gentle of evolving concerns such as environmental sustainability and energy efficiency, building codes are additionally altering. Updated regulations might dictate the inclusion of energy-efficient materials or sustainable building practices. Understanding these tendencies is significant for those seeking to develop or renovate properties in a contemporary context.

What inspections will my project need after acquiring a building permit?undefinedOnce you've a building permit, inspections will usually be required at numerous stages of your project to make sure compliance with building codes and safety requirements. Common inspections include foundation, framing, electrical, plumbing, and final inspections. Check along with your building department for specific requirements.
